The Role of a Modern Window Installer: Expertise in a Changing Landscape

In the realm of home improvement and construction, window installation is an important service that has actually evolved together with modern advancements in technology and design. Modern window installers play a critical role in guaranteeing the security, effectiveness, and visual appeal of residential and commercial structures. This article explores their responsibilities, the skills needed, and the significance of their work in today's hectic environment.

The Evolution of Window Installation

Historically, window installation was a labor-intensive job relying greatly on manual skills. Over the decades, however, it has changed due to developments in materials, innovation, and construction methods. The modern window installer is now trained not just in conventional installation techniques but also in the application of innovative technologies and sustainable products.

The Importance of Window Installation

Windows are integral parts of any building, affecting energy effectiveness, interior lighting, looks, and security. Subsequently, the know-how of a window installer is vital for numerous reasons:

  • Energy Efficiency: Proper installation guarantees that windows fit comfortably, decreasing drafts and improving insulation.
  • Safety: Correct installation is important for the structural stability of a building, avoiding issues like water damage and mold.
  • Aesthetic Appeal: Well-installed windows enhance the outside and interior decorations of a building, increasing residential or commercial property worth.
  • Performance: Windows that open and close efficiently, seal properly, and keep ventilation contribute positively to indoor comfort.

Key Responsibilities of a Modern Window Installer

Comprehensive Skill Set

Today's window installers should have a varied variety of skills to be efficient. These include:

  1. Technical Proficiency: Knowledge in utilizing specialized tools and equipment for window measurement, cutting frames, and installation.
  2. Product Knowledge: Familiarity with various window materials, including vinyl, wood, aluminum, and composite products.
  3. Problem-Solving Ability: Aptitude for troubleshooting installation issues, such as positioning issues or structural challenges.
  4. Attention to Detail: Precision in measurement and cutting to guarantee a perfect fit that adheres to building codes and standards.
  5. Safety Awareness: Understanding and implementing safety procedures to protect themselves and others throughout the installation procedure.

Actions in Modern Window Installation

The procedure of window installation is systematic, ensuring quality and effectiveness. The primary actions normally consist of:

  1. Assessment: Evaluating the window opening and determining measurements precisely.
  2. Selection: Advising clients on window designs, products, and energy rankings to fulfill their requirements and preferences.
  3. Preparation: Removing old windows and preparing the frame for the new installation.
  4. Installation: Aligning, protecting, and sealing brand-new windows to guarantee correct fit and insulation.
  5. Finishing Touches: Caulking, trimming, and cleaning the installation area, while supplying customer guidelines on care and upkeep.

The Impact of Technology on Window Installation

Similar to many sectors, the rise of innovation has reshaped the role of window installers. New tools and applications enhance the precision and performance of installations. For example:

  • Laser Measurement Tools: These replace traditional measuring tapes and provide exact measurements, which are vital for a best fit.
  • Structure Information Modeling (BIM): This innovation enables installers to imagine the project in a virtual setting before actual work starts, enhancing preparation and accuracy.
  • Smart Windows: Modern installers may frequently work with smart window innovations that can adjust to changes in light and temperature, enabling for improved energy management.

Expenses of Window Installation

Comprehending the costs related to window installation can assist property owners better manage their spending plans. Elements influencing the overall cost consist of:

  • Type of windows chosen (e.g., double-glazed vs. single-glazed)
  • Level of personalization (shapes, sizes, colors)
  • Installation complexity
  • Labor charges

Here's a breakdown of potential costs for various window types:

Window TypeTypical Cost (per window)
Single-Hung₤ 150 - ₤ 400
Double-Hung₤ 300 - ₤ 600
Casement₤ 250 - ₤ 750
Repaired Pane₤ 200 - ₤ 500
Bay/Bow₤ 1,000 - ₤ 3,500

FAQs About Modern Window Installation

1. What are the very best materials for windows?

The very best materials depend upon various aspects, consisting of climate and individual choices. Typical options consist of vinyl for cost, wood for looks, and fiberglass for resilience.

2. How typically should windows be changed?

Usually, windows should be examined every 15 to 20 years, however indications such as drafts, condensation, or difficulty opening and closing might indicate the requirement for replacement earlier.

3. What is the typical period for window installation?

A basic installation for several windows may take one to two days. However, the timeframe can vary based upon the number of windows and any unforeseen structural problems.
